On Fri, 10 Feb 2023 11:33:59 +0530, Kathiravan T wrote: > Enable the support for download mode to collect the RAM dumps if > system crashes, to perform the post mortem analysis. > > During the bootup, bootloaders initialize the SMEM. However the bootup > after crash, SMEM will not be initialized again. If the memory for the > SMEM is not reserved, linux consumes that region, which leads to the > loss of SMEM data. So, during the next bootup after crash, bootloaders > will hang due to invalid data present in the SMEM region. Due to this, > added the SMEM support along with this series. > > [...]
